An Efficient Generation Method for Uniformly Distributed Random Numbers
B. Ya. Ryabko, E. P. Machikina
Abstract:
The problem of constructing efficient methods for generating uniformly distributed random numbers from nonuniformly distributed ones with a given arbitrarily small error is considered. An estimate of the complexity of these methods is given as a function of the error, which is measured as the deviation of numbers generated from uniformly distributed. Methods whose complexity is lower in order than that of known methods are proposed.
